SpaceX sticks with lawsuit over launch competition

Update: A federal district judge in California ruled against SpaceX and ordered its case against the Air Force to be vacated. The order was issued under seal on Sept. 24, but an Oct. 2 filing indicated that the court decided in the Air Force’s favor on all of SpaceX’s claims.

Previously: In August, SpaceX said it would keep pursuing its lawsuit against the federal government as well as its rivals in the launch industry, including Amazon CEO Jeff Bezos’ Blue Origin space venture, even though it’s been cleared for billions of dollars in contracts for national security space missions.

Both sides in the long-running dispute laid out their positions in a notice filed in U.S. District Court in Los Angeles on Aug. 14, a week after the U.S. Space Force announced that United Launch Alliance and SpaceX were the winners in a competition for future launches.

Leading up to that decision, the Air Force provided hundreds of millions of dollars in development funding for ULA as well as Blue Origin and Orbital Sciences Corp. (now part of Northrop Grumman). SpaceX was left out but protested the awards.

In the August filing, SpaceX said the funding gave ULA an “unwarranted advantage” and called for the Space Force’s Space and Missile Systems Center to “rectify” its errors, presumably by providing more funding for SpaceX.

Lawyers for the federal government and ULA said the competition for development funding was decided fairly. They said no rectification was warranted, especially considering that SpaceX proposed its Starship super-rocket for development funding but ended up offering a different launch vehicle  — a modified Falcon Heavy rocket — for the Space Force’s future heavy-lift launches.

ULA and SpaceX win shares of Space Force launches

The U.S. Space Force designated United Launch Alliance and SpaceX as the winners of a multibillion-dollar competition for national security launches over a five-year period, passing up a proposal from Amazon CEO Jeff Bezos’ Blue Origin space venture in the process.

Northrop Grumman and its OmegA rocket also lost out in the Phase II competition for the National Security Space Launch program.

ULA will receive a 60% share of the launch manifest for contracts awarded in the 2020-2024 time frame, with the first missions launching in fiscal 2022, said William Roper, assistant secretary of the Air Force for acquisition, technology and logistics.

SpaceX will receive the other 40%.

The competition extended through the creation of the U.S. Space Force, whose Space and Missile Systems Center will be in charge of executing the launches in partnership with the National Reconnaissance Office.

The five-year Phase II program provides for fixed-price but indefinite-delivery contracts, which means there isn’t a specified total payout. But Roper said it’d be reasonable to estimate that somewhere around 32 to 34 launches would be covered, which would translate to billions of dollars in business.

Three launches were assigned today: ULA is scheduled to launch two missions known as USSF-51 and USSF-106 for the Space Force in 2022, while SpaceX has been assigned USSF-67 in mid-2022.

ULA’s two contracts amount to $337 million, and SpaceX’s contract is worth $316 million. Roper said details about the payloads are classified.

BlackSky will track COVID-19 impact for Air Force

BlackSky, a satellite data venture with offices in Seattle, says it’s won a U.S. Air Force contract to track the effects of the coronavirus pandemic on military interests worldwide.

The contract calls for BlackSky to monitor U.S. military bases overseas and assess the status of supply chains, using its AI-enabled Spectra geospatial data analysis platform.

Spectra can analyze satellite data as well as news feeds and social media postings to identify anomalies worth following up on with additional imagery or investigation. The data inputs include imagery from BlackSky’s own satellite constellation as well as from other sources.

BlackSky has benefited from Pentagon contracts for years, but this latest project focuses on impacts related to the COVID-19 outbreak.

The approach was demonstrated for GeekWire back in May, when BlackSky executives showed how satellite images could be compared to detect an unusual rise or fall in, say, the number of cars parked in a lot outside a given installation. That could point to places where social distancing is decreasing or increasing.

Spectra can also analyze activity at airports, loading docks, maintenance facilities, fuel storage depots and other key installations to assess how supply chains might be affected by pandemic-related bottlenecks.

Such analyses can be compared with reported infection numbers coming from local governments, and integrated into computer models to predict the risk to deployed Air Force personnel and the surrounding communities.

White House CFO becomes Pentagon’s top techie

White House chief technology officer Michael Kratsios ⁠— who enlisted Amazon, Microsoft and other key players in artificial intelligence and cloud computing to fight COVID-19 ⁠— has himself been recruited for another role as the Defense Department’s top official for technology.

President Donald Trump is designating Kratsios to serve as the acting under secretary of defense for research and engineering — in effect, the Pentagon’s CTO. Kratsios will also keep his CTO role in the White House Office of Science and Technology Policy.

The previous under secretary in charge of defense tech, Mike Griffin, stepped down last week to pursue “a private-sector opportunity” along with his deputy.

Kratsios will be in the prime position to help the Pentagon pursue opportunities in emerging technologies such as AI, automation, quantum computing, robotics and 5G wireless services — frontiers that have drawn increasing attention under Defense Secretary Mark Esper.

SpaceX launches GPS III satellite for Space Force

A SpaceX Falcon 9 rocket launched the third in a series of next-generation GPS III satellites into orbit today, marking another step forward for America’s satellite-based navigation system and the Space Force that manages it.

X-37 space plane begins shadowy orbital mission

A United Launch Alliance Atlas 5 rocket launched a Boeing-built X-37B space plane today on a semi-secret orbital mission under the management of the recently created Space Force.

Anduril expands to Seattle for defense tech

Anduril HQ
One of Anduril’s sentry towers stands tall at the company’s HQ in California’s Orange County. (Anduril Photo)

Irvine, Calif.-based Anduril Industries says it’s opening a new office in Seattle and will be hiring engineers to work on defense technologies.

“We are building bigger and better systems for our military as quickly as we can,” Palmer Luckey, the venture’s founder, said in a news release. “The incredible pool of talent in the Seattle area helps us accelerate that.”

Founded in 2017, Anduril develops hardware and software centered around Lattice, an AI backbone allowing for real-time information analysis across the company’s range of products. Those products include a surveillance drone called the Ghost, an interceptor drone called the Anvil, medical transport drones and a border monitoring system that relies on sensor-equipped sentry towers.

Space Force X-37B mission to test power beaming

X-37B space plane
The Pentagon’s X-37B space plane is encapsulated within the payload fairing of its Atlas 5 launch vehicle. (Boeing Photo)

When a Boeing-built X-37B space plane is sent into orbit this month for the test program’s sixth flight, it will try out a technology that’s been more than a decade in the making: space-based solar power.

An experiment designed by the U.S. Naval Research Laboratory will transform solar power into a microwave beam, potentially for transmission to the ground. If such a power-beaming system could be perfected, concentrated microwave energy from space could conceivably be converted to electricity for far-flung military outposts.

Back in 2007, the Pentagon issued a report saying the U.S. military could be an “anchor tenant customer” for space-based power generation systems. That report piggybacked on a NASA study that was written a decade earlier, assessing the feasibility of wireless power transmission from space.

Boeing rolls out first ‘Loyal Wingman’ AI drone

A Boeing-led team has presented the Royal Australian Air Force with its first “Loyal Wingman” aircraft, an AI-equipped drone that’s designed to fly in coordination with crewed military airplanes.

Navy ‘officially’ releases widely seen UFO videos

The Defense Department has authorized the release of three unclassified Navy videos, captured in 2004 and 2015, that purport to show unidentified flying objects — or to use the Pentagon’s preferred term, unidentified aerial phenomena.
